Serbia - Health Services Nominal Expenditure Per Capita
Since 2013, Serbia Health Services Nominal Expenditure Per Capita jumped by 0.2% year on year. In 2018, the country was number 34 comparing other countries in Health Services Nominal Expenditure Per Capita at €420 Per Capita. Serbia is overtaken by Montenegro, which was number 33 at €425 Per Capita and is followed by Bosnia and Herzegovina with €358 Per Capita. Switzerland topped the ranking with €6,536 Per Capita in 2018, an increase of 4.2% compared to 2017. Norway, Iceland and Denmark resp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Slovakia recorded the best 5 years average growth at +25% per year, while Turkey witnessed the worst performance at -9.5% per year.
